— Annual production totalled 3 561t in 2021 2% higher than 2020 but still lower than 2019 and 3% lower than 2018 which stands as the year during which most gold was mined 1 Production strength in the first half of the year 5% higher y o y gave way to weakness in H2 Output in H2 2021 was unchanged compared to H2 2020

— Chinese production exceeded 300t for the first time in 2009 while production ranged from 210t to 227t in the other three countries each down from the amounts produced in 2008
